PSP games introduced a revolutionary shift in gaming by bringing console-quality experiences into a portable format. The PlayStation Portable allowed players to enjoy deep, complex games on the go, changing how people interacted with console games in everyday life. PSP games covered a wide range of genres, including action, racing, and role-playing, all optimized for handheld play. Despite hardware limitations, many PSP titles delivered impressive depth and creativity, proving that great design can overcome technical constraints and still produce some of the best games of their time.
